On July 13, a strategic planning mini-summit was held with an event called the "idea marketplace." The idea marketplace is an opportunity to see early-stage ideas that may become part of the university's strategic plan. The purpose of the marketplace was to explore and identify the best ideas for potential inclusion into the strategic plan.  As part of the process, the idea posters created for the mini-summit will be at the Lake Campus on July 23 from 1:30 – 3:30 pm for review and feedback. Posters will be located around the Student Services lobby area for your convenience.

Members of the Lake Campus and surrounding community are invited to view the idea posters, ask questions, and provide feedback to the project teams.  The feedback will assist the teams in further examining the ideas, refining them, and presenting them to the Leadership Committee for additional feedback.
